Vented Skylight Installation in Columbia, MO
Vented skylight installation services provide property owners with a way to add natural light and improved ventilation to various spaces within a home. These skylights are designed to be installed in roofs, allowing fresh air and daylight to enter attics, bathrooms, kitchens, or other areas where enhanced airflow and illumination are desired. Projects typically involve assessing the roof structure, selecting appropriate skylight models, and ensuring proper sealing to prevent leaks. Homeowners often request this service when seeking to increase energy efficiency, reduce reliance on artificial lighting, or improve indoor air quality.
Before requesting vented skylight installation, property owners usually want to understand the different types of skylights available, such as manually or electrically operated models, and how they can be integrated into existing roof designs. It’s also important to consider the placement for optimal light and airflow, as well as any potential impacts on roofing materials and warranties. Clear communication about the scope of work, compatibility with the roof structure, and the desired features can help ensure the project meets expectations.

Vented Skylight Installation Questions
What are vented skylights? Vented skylights are roof windows that open to allow fresh air and natural light into a space, improving ventilation and brightness.
Where are vented skylights suitable? They are ideal for kitchens, bathrooms, or any room where additional airflow and daylight are desired.
What should property owners consider before installation? The roof type, skylight size, and placement are important factors to ensure proper fit and operation.
How do vented skylights improve indoor comfort? They help reduce humidity and heat buildup by providing natural ventilation, enhancing overall indoor air quality.
